Huawei Pocket 2 Confirmed to Launch on February 22

The Huawei Pocket 2 will soon be available in China. The foldable smartphone’s launch date was disclosed by the company, but not much else was disclosed. The device is anticipated to replace the November 2022 Chinese launch of the Huawei Pocket S. It is anticipated that the next flip-foldable phone will arrive with improvements over the previous model. The Huawei Pocket 2’s color options and finishes have been hinted at in some recent design leaks.

Huawei has officially announced that the Huawei Pocket 2 will launch on February 22 at 2:30 pm local time (12 pm IST) in a Weibo post. Although the teaser does not explicitly reveal the phone’s design, it does allude to two circular modules that resemble.

The rear panel design hint matches previous leaks. It is anticipated that the Huawei Pocket 2 will be available in black, purple, and white color options—the latter of which has a pattern resembling marble. In the meantime, the purple version with the imitation leather finish was spotted. The phone is anticipated to have a larger battery than the previous model, a Kirin 9000s SoC, and triple rear camera units.

The Huawei Pocket S is notable for having an outer 1.04-inch circular OLED display and a 6.9-inch 120Hz OLED primary screen. It has a 4,000mAh battery that supports 40W wired charging, Qualcomm’s Snapdragon 778G SoC, and HarmonyOS 3 preinstalled. The smartphone has a 40-megapixel primary sensor and a 13-megapixel sensor with an ultrawide angle lens on its dual rear camera, and a 10.7-megapixel sensor on its front camera.

Initially available in Frost Silver, Ice Crystal Blue, Mint Green, Obsidian Black, Primrose Gold, and Sakura Pink colorways, the Huawei Pocket S cost CNY 5,988 (approximately Rs. 67,900) when it was first released in China. The 8GB + 256GB and 8GB + 512GB versions of the clamshell foldable model were also released; they were priced at CNY 6,488 (about Rs. 73,600) and CNY 7,488 (about Rs. 84,900), respectively.
